Хорошо, это сводит меня с ума.
Запуск sendmail на CentOS. Он работает, и слушает 25:
[root@mysqlslavebackup ~]# nmap -sS -O -sV 127.0.0.1
Starting Nmap 4.11 ( http://www.insecure.org/nmap/ ) at 2013-03-21 10:46 PDD<br>
Interesting ports on localhost.localdomain (127.0.0.1):<br>
Not shown: 1665 closed ports<br>
PORT STATE SERVICE VERSION<br>
22/tcp open ssh OpenSSH 4.3 (protocol 2.0)<br>
25/tcp open smtp Sendmail 8.13.8/8.13.8<br>
53/tcp open domain<br>
111/tcp open rpc<br>
631/tcp open ipp CUPS 1.2<br>
739/tcp open rpc<br>
953/tcp open rndc?<br>
3306/tcp open mysql MySQL 5.5.11-enterprise-commercial-advanced-log<br>
5901/tcp open vnc VNC (protocol 3.8)<br>
5902/tcp open vnc VNC (protocol 3.8)<br>
5903/tcp open vnc VNC (protocol 3.8)<br>
6001/tcp open X11 (access denied)<br>
6002/tcp open X11 (access denied)<br>
6003/tcp open X11 (access denied)<br>
Я могу подключиться к 25 через telnet с локального хоста, но с любого другого компьютера порт, похоже, закрыт. iptables выключены, и даже если они были, у меня есть запись для открытия порта.
Не могу, хоть убей, понять, что это было бы, кроме того факта, что раньше это был почтовый сервер Zimbra, но он был удален, и в привязках портов об этом нет записи.
Любой ввод был бы потрясающим! Спасибо!
Почему я не могу получать внешнюю почту / входящие SMTP-соединения? [Sendmail и другие серверы MTA]
Ты конечно ваш sendmail не слушает ТОЛЬКО на интерфейсе обратной связи? [127.0.0.1:25]
Это конфигурация по умолчанию во многих дистрибутивах.
Вы можете использовать netstat -ant| grep :25
проверить это.
Sendail FAQ 4.22: Почему я не могу получать внешнюю почту?
Вкратце: вам может потребоваться закомментировать строку DAEMON_OPTIONS с 127.0.0.1 в вашем sendail.mc и перекомпилировать ее в sendmail.cf.